andMr. Fox asked the Minister for Education if he will state, in respect of the latest year for which figures are available, the average number of pupils per teacher in secondary schools; and what number of pupils per teacher is considered satisfactory in such schools.
Ceisteanna — Questions. Oral Answers. - Secondary School Pupils.
47.
The average number of pupils per whole-time teacher in secondary schools for the school year 1970-71 was 18. A pupil/teacher ratio of 20:1 would be considered satisfactory.
